This box is one of about thirty I did for the Estate Agents Allsop's. These were presented three years running for the winning participants in their own internal squash competition.



Each triangular box was designed to contain 3 squash balls so was about 5" to a side.

As they were all dyed black I now can't remember what wood they were made from. I do remember that the dying process was difficult as the dye didn't seem to want to sit in the grain of whatever wood it was. The solution involved filling the grain with a black dyed filler before a second dying.

The joints of these were 60 degree mitres, strengthened by mitre keys. They were satin finished using a wax polish.
